Job Description
JOB LEVEL -- Multiple positions from entry to senior depending on your skill and experience level
JOB DESCRIPTION
Are you looking to be part of a technology team beyond the ordinary? A place full of interesting challenges and the engineers up to solving them? Then welcome to Financial Engineering. This is the place where the models become software, where many of the numbers that drive our business decisions are produced. Our systems are used for interest rate and credit risk management, investment analysis and trading, security issuance, automated loan underwriting, distressed loan decisions, economic and regulatory capital, property valuation, financial reporting, economic and GAAP forecasting, and more! If you have strong technology background, experience with mission-critical applications, and thrive on rigorous software development process, apply for a senior developer position in the Risk/P&L trading technology team.
YOUR WORK FALLS INTO THREE PRIMARY CATEGORIES:
REQUIREMENTS DEVELOPMENT
· Work with users and/or senior team members to determine requirements
· Participate in solution design
· Proactively identify areas of automation and other technical enhancements
CODE DEVELOPMENT
· Develop and maintain high-quality software code and automated tests including Unit, Functional, Performance, and Acceptance
· Promote industry-leading design practices for mission-critical applications to ensure predictable results, production resilience, high performance, and responsiveness
· Perform detailed reviews; challenge code and test quality, efficacy and coverage
PRODUCTION SUPPORT
· Take part in production problems troubleshooting and remediation
· Clearly craft and articulate messages (both written and verbal) to a variety of stakeholders
QUALIFICATIONS:
· 2 + years of developing software solutions through full lifecycle
· 2+ years of experience and expert understanding of object-oriented programming concepts
· 2+ years of experience and programming skills in Java, C++ or similar
· 1+ years of experience in database and/or UI development
· Experience in grid computing and/or low latency transactional systems
· BSc in Computer Science or similar
· Prefered: Advanced degree; knowledge of Fixed Income and/or Finance Analytics
KEY TO SUCCESS IN THIS POSITION
· Bringing an analytical and imaginative mindset to work every day
· Disciplined approach to software coding and testing
· Desire to ensure customer satisfaction
· Communication and interpersonal skills working in a collaborative team and interacting with business customers
Company Description
www.intelagile.com